Fridge Types for Different Spaces

Selecting the best fridge for World Samosa Day celebrations requires understanding the different types of fridges suitable for various spaces. Whether you need a fridge for your home or an outdoor setting, it's essential to choose one that meets your storage needs and keeps your samosas fresh.

Fridge Options for Homes

When considering fridge options for your home, it's important to think about the space available and your specific requirements. Here are some popular choices:

  1. Top-Freezer Refrigerators: These fridges have a freezer compartment on top and a refrigerator section below. They are often more affordable and provide ample storage space for both frozen and fresh items.

  2. Bottom-Freezer Refrigerators: With the freezer compartment located at the bottom, these fridges make it easier to access fresh food stored at eye level. They are ideal for those who use the refrigerator section more frequently.

  3. Side-by-Side Refrigerators: These fridges have the freezer and refrigerator compartments next to each other, offering equal access to both. They are suitable for narrow kitchen spaces and provide a good balance of storage for both fresh and frozen items.

  4. French Door Refrigerators: These models feature two doors that open to a wide refrigerator section, with a freezer drawer at the bottom. They offer a stylish design and convenient access to fresh food.

Fridge Type Ideal For Storage Capacity (cu ft)
Top-Freezer Refrigerator Budget-conscious users 18 - 22
Bottom-Freezer Refrigerator Frequent fresh food access 18 - 25
Side-by-Side Refrigerator Narrow kitchen spaces 22 - 28
French Door Refrigerator Stylish design and convenience 20 - 28

Organizing Your Fridge for World Samosa Day

When celebrating World Samosa Day, organizing your fridge efficiently is key to ensuring your samosas and other ingredients stay fresh and ready to serve. Here are some tips to help you arrange your fridge and maintain food freshness.

Tips for Arranging Your Fridge

  1. Categorize Food Items: Group similar items together for easy access. Place vegetables in the crisper drawer, dairy products on upper shelves, and meats on the bottom shelf to prevent cross-contamination.
  2. Use Clear Containers: Store leftovers and prepped ingredients in clear containers. This helps you quickly identify contents and reduces food waste.
  3. Label Your Food: Label containers with the date of preparation or expiration. This helps you keep track of freshness.
  4. Optimize Shelf Space: Arrange items to utilize vertical space. Use stackable containers and shelf organizers.
  5. Maintain Air Circulation: Avoid overloading the fridge to ensure proper air circulation, which helps maintain a consistent temperature.
  6. Keep Frequently Used Items Accessible: Place frequently used items like condiments and drinks in the door compartments for easy access.

Maintaining Food Freshness

Keeping your food fresh is essential, especially when preparing for a celebration like World Samosa Day. Here are some tips to maintain freshness:

  1. Proper Temperature Settings: Set your fridge to the recommended temperature, typically between 35°F and 38°F (1.6°C and 3.3°C), to slow down bacterial growth and keep food fresh. Refer to our article on best compact freezer for a low energy house for more details on temperature control.
  2. Use Airtight Containers: Store leftovers and ingredients in airtight containers to prevent moisture loss and odor transfer.
  3. Utilize the Crisper Drawer: Use the crisper drawer for fruits and vegetables, adjusting the humidity settings to suit the produce type. High humidity is ideal for leafy greens, while low humidity is better for fruits.
  4. Practice First In, First Out (FIFO): Arrange food items so that older products are at the front and newer ones at the back. This ensures that older items are used first, reducing the risk of spoilage.

Creative Ways to Serve Samosas

Samosas are versatile and can be served in various creative ways to delight your guests. Here are a few ideas:

  • Samosa Platter: Arrange a variety of samosas with different fillings on a large platter. Accompany them with an assortment of chutneys and dips.
  • Samosa Chaat: Break samosas into pieces and top with yogurt, tamarind chutney, mint chutney, chopped onions, tomatoes, and sev for a delicious chaat.
  • Samosa Sandwich: Place a samosa between slices of bread, add some lettuce, and drizzle with your favorite sauce for a quick and tasty sandwich.
  • Samosa Wraps: Use samosas as a filling for wraps, adding some fresh veggies and a tangy sauce for a healthy twist.
  • Samosa Salad: Crumble samosas over a bed of greens, add chickpeas, cucumbers, and a tangy dressing for a refreshing salad.
